I am a screenprinter. I could send some to try if not a huge piece. If you find some anywhere else make sure to get the finest mesh count you can like 110 would be fine but maybe not tight enough. 120 would be better.

porous polypropylene is what they use. he sells there at tjs precut...Benjamin is who you want to talk to..
